Under California energy standards, duct leakage in many new and altered systems must be verified by which method?
a.Visual inspection only
b.A duct leakage (pressurization) test by a certified rater or installer
c.A refrigerant pressure test
d.A combustion analysis
Giải thích
Title 24 requires duct leakage testing for many new installations and changeouts, typically verified through a pressurization test. Sealing ducts reduces energy waste and improves delivered airflow. Results are often confirmed by a HERS rater.
